import logging
from app.adapters.agent_mqtt_adapter import AgentMQTTAdapter
from app.adapters.hub_http_adapter import HubHttpAdapter
from app.adapters.hub_mqtt_adapter import HubMqttAdapter
from config import (
MQTT_BROKER_HOST,
MQTT_BROKER_PORT,
MQTT_TOPIC,
HUB_URL,
HUB_MQTT_BROKER_HOST,
HUB_MQTT_BROKER_PORT,
HUB_MQTT_TOPIC,
)
if __name__ == "__main__":
# Configure logging settings
logging.basicConfig(
level=logging.INFO, # Set the log level to INFO (you can use logging.DEBUG for more detailed logs)
format="[%(asctime)s] [%(levelname)s] [%(module)s] %(message)s",
handlers=[
logging.StreamHandler(), # Output log messages to the console
logging.FileHandler("app.log"), # Save log messages to a file
],
)
# Create an instance of the StoreApiAdapter using the configuration
# hub_adapter = HubHttpAdapter(
# api_base_url=HUB_URL,
# )
hub_adapter = HubMqttAdapter(
broker=HUB_MQTT_BROKER_HOST,
port=HUB_MQTT_BROKER_PORT,
topic=HUB_MQTT_TOPIC,
)
# Create an instance of the AgentMQTTAdapter using the configuration
agent_adapter = AgentMQTTAdapter(
broker_host=MQTT_BROKER_HOST,
broker_port=MQTT_BROKER_PORT,
topic=MQTT_TOPIC,
hub_gateway=hub_adapter,
)
try:
# Connect to the MQTT broker and start listening for messages
agent_adapter.connect()
agent_adapter.start()
# Keep the system running indefinitely (you can add other logic as needed)
while True:
pass
except KeyboardInterrupt:
# Stop the MQTT adapter and exit gracefully if interrupted by the user
agent_adapter.stop()
logging.info("System stopped.")
